Choosing the Right Mesh Making System for Agro Shade Nets
When acquiring a fabric making machine for crop sun fabrics, it's vital to assess several elements. Output amount is significant; a limited farm might require a compact machine, while a larger business will require a high-volume model. In addition, evaluate mechanization stages and offered capabilities to improve productivity and minimize workforce costs. Ultimately, financial plan and servicing demands should be thoroughly reviewed before making a final choice.
Investing in a Shade Net Making Machine: Costs & Benefits
Considering acquiring a shade fabric manufacturing machine? The initial cost can seem considerable. Usually, prices vary from about $5,000 to $30,000+, depending the size and features. However, the ongoing upsides often exceed this preliminary price. Increased output of shade nets permits for substantial revenue and lowers staffing costs. Furthermore, possessing your own device gives greater management over standard and distribution deadlines, allowing your enterprise more aggressive. In conclusion, a shade mesh production device can be a smart investment for producers and businesses participating in agriculture and cover alternatives.
